Mebendazole is a drug used to treat infections caused by various nematodes (roundworms). It works by inhibiting the formation of microtubules in worms and depleting their glucose levels. Mebendazole is typically used as a single 100mg dose or twice daily doses for 3 days to treat infections like pinworm, roundworm, and hookworm. Common side effects are mild and include n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ea. Mebendazole is contraindicated in pregnancy and those hypersensitive to it, and safety in young children is not established.
